Daughters – Part 4: Daughters of Dignity

The fourth part of Erin Nicole Thompson's' Daughters Series.

“But you are a chosen people, a royal priesthood, a holy nation, God’s special possession, that you may declare the praises of him who called you out of darkness into his wonderful light.” 1 Peter 2:9

In the world’s eyes, I don’t have the most dignified job. I am a booger-wiping, diaper-changing, crumb-cleaning, stay-at-home mom. I went through a phase where I was trying to find a more sophisticated title for what I do. I tried Domestic Engineer, CEO of Home Operations, Emperor-ess of the Thompson Universe, Managing Officer of Local Personnel, Executive Director of Little Human Resources, but none of them stuck.

Yet despite needing to pick dehydrated french-fries off of my mini-van floor, I am reminded that as God’s daughter I have a dignified and honored role.

“But you are a chosen people, a royal priesthood, a holy nation, God’s special possession, that you may declare the praises of him who called you out of darkness into his wonderful light” (1 Pet. 2:9).

Did you here that? As a child of God, we are a chosen people. As a daughter of the King, we are a royal priesthood. Before Jesus walked the earth, the priests had the distinguished role to be set apart to serve God and offer him sacrifices in the temple. These sacrifices paid for the sins of the people and served to worship God. Because of the death of Christ Jesus we don’t have go about the same priest- hood procedures. But we do have the distinguished honor to worship God and offer him our lives.

“Therefore, I urge you, brothers and sisters, in view of God’s mercy, to offer your bodies as a living sacrifice, holy and pleasing to God—this is your true and proper worship. Do not conform to the pattern of this world, but be transformed by the renewing of your mind. Then you will be able to test and approve what God’s will is—his good, pleasing and perfect will” (Rom. 12:1-2).

Bringing our best to God as we strive to know, worship, and serve him is our spiritual offering. There will always be peaks and valleys in our attempts. Seasons in which we stray. But the general trajectory of our lives should be to pursue God with all we are. If we do that, we will serve Him well as part of the royal priesthood.

In addition to our dignified position, we are part of the Church as God builds up his spiritual family. In verse 9, we are called “a chosen generation, a royal priesthood, a holy nation.” These terms indicate we are a unique community called by God. We are to represent him in our world. There is nothing like us in all the earth. The church is unique. The church is chosen, royal, holy, and “God’s own” in a way that no other people are.

In your heart of hearts, you can rest assured knowing that you are chosen. In your mind’s eye, you can know that you are set apart. You are God’s own special possession and a critical player in a dynasty that God is building called the Church. No matter what your occupation here on earth, as a daughter of the King, you have a dignified duty to be part of a royal priesthood. And there is nothing else like it in all the earth!

Father, you have given us a distinguished position in your Kingdom. To be chosen, royal, and set apart for you is an honor beyond our comprehension. Help us to live in such a way that our lives become a fragrant offering to you. Love, Your Daughters
